Saudi Arabia executed 184 people in 2019 the most in six years, human rights organization Reprieve said on Monday. Of those executed, 88 were Saudi nationals, 90 were foreign nationals and 6 were of unknown nationality, Reprieve said in a statement. "This is another grim milestone for Mohammed Bin Salman's Saudi Arabia," Reprieve director Maya Foa said. "The Kingdom's rulers clearly believe they have total impunity to flout international law ...
